WebApr 10, 2024 · Triple-negative breast cancer (TNBC) is one of the most aggressive forms of breast cancer and constitutes 10–20% of all breast cancer cases. Even though platinum-based drugs such as cisplatin and carboplatin are effective in TNBC patients, their toxicity and development of cancer drug resistance often hamper their clinical use. WebCarboplatin (NSC 241240, JM-8, CBDCA,Paraplatin) is a DNA synthesis inhibitor by binding to DNA and interfering with the cell's repair mechanism in A2780, SKOV-3, IGROV-1, and HX62 cells. Solutions are best fresh-prepared. DMSO is not recommended to dissolve platinum-based drugs, which can easily lead to drug inactivation.
